怎么用手机学编程做游戏

时间:2025-01-27 20:07:00 网络游戏

使用手机学编程做游戏可以通过以下步骤进行:

选择合适的编程游戏

在手机应用商店中搜索并选择一款适合初学者的编程游戏,如“编程之星”、“编程方块”和“编程机器人”等。

了解游戏规则和目标

在开始玩之前,先了解游戏的规则和目标,这些信息通常可以在游戏的介绍或帮助文档中找到。

学习编程基础知识

建议先学习一些基础的编程知识,如编程概念、语法和常用指令。可以通过在线教程、视频教程或编程学习应用程序来学习,如Codecademy、SoloLearn和Khan Academy等。

开始游戏并尝试编程

打开选择的编程游戏,并开始尝试编程挑战。根据游戏的要求,使用编程语言(如Python、JavaScript或Blockly)编写代码,通过逻辑和算法解决游戏中的难题。

逐步提高难度

随着编程技能不断提高,尝试挑战更高难度的关卡和任务,以进一步巩固和扩展编程知识。

参与社区和寻求帮助

加入编程游戏的社区,与其他编程爱好者交流经验和技巧。可以在论坛、社交媒体或游戏内的聊天室中寻求帮助和分享学习心得。

此外,还有一些手机软件可以帮助你进行编程学习,如:

SoloLearn:提供多种编程语言的基础课程,包括Python、Java、C++等,用户可以通过文档、视频和小测验来学习新知识。

Mimo:通过游戏化的学习体验吸引用户,课程内容涵盖HTML、CSS、Java和Python等语言,用户通过完成任务和挑战来获取积分和奖励。

Programming Hub:提供详细的教程和大量的编程示例,涵盖多种语言及概念,支持离线学习。

Khan Academy:提供深入的视频课程和富有挑战性的编程练习,帮助用户从基础到进阶逐步掌握编程技巧。

Unity:跨平台的游戏开发引擎,支持多种编程语言,如C、JavaScript和Boo等,适合开发2D和3D游戏。

Unreal Engine:强大的游戏开发引擎,支持蓝图脚本和C++编程,适合制作AAA级游戏。

Cocos2d-x:基于C++的开源游戏引擎,支持多种编程语言,如C++、Lua和JavaScript等,适合开发2D游戏。

GameMaker Studio:适用于初学者的游戏开发工具,拥有友好的图形化界面和简单易用的拖拽式编程环境。

Corona SDK:基于Lua语言的跨平台游戏开发框架,适合2D游戏的制作。

通过这些步骤和工具,你可以利用手机轻松学习编程并制作游戏。